Install nvim-toggle-terminal plugin
This commit is contained in:
@@ -22,5 +22,6 @@ Plug 'yuezk/vim-js'
|
|||||||
Plug 'lukas-reineke/indent-blankline.nvim'
|
Plug 'lukas-reineke/indent-blankline.nvim'
|
||||||
Plug 'lewis6991/gitsigns.nvim'
|
Plug 'lewis6991/gitsigns.nvim'
|
||||||
Plug 'nvim-lua/plenary.nvim'
|
Plug 'nvim-lua/plenary.nvim'
|
||||||
|
Plug 'caenrique/nvim-toggle-terminal'
|
||||||
|
|
||||||
call plug#end()
|
call plug#end()
|
||||||
|
|||||||
@@ -30,12 +30,13 @@ noremap <leader>nh :nohl<CR>
|
|||||||
" Use Ctrl+A to select the whole file
|
" Use Ctrl+A to select the whole file
|
||||||
nnoremap <C-a> ggVG
|
nnoremap <C-a> ggVG
|
||||||
|
|
||||||
function! OpenTerminal()
|
" function! OpenTerminal()
|
||||||
split term://bash
|
" split term://bash
|
||||||
resize 10
|
" resize 10
|
||||||
endfunction
|
" endfunction
|
||||||
" Open terminal
|
" " Open terminal
|
||||||
nnoremap <leader>t :call OpenTerminal()<CR>
|
" nnoremap <leader>t :call OpenTerminal()<CR>
|
||||||
|
nnoremap <leader>t :ToggleTerminal<CR>
|
||||||
|
|
||||||
" Open splits
|
" Open splits
|
||||||
nnoremap <leader>v :vs<CR>
|
nnoremap <leader>v :vs<CR>
|
||||||
@@ -44,3 +45,6 @@ nnoremap <leader>vv :sp<CR>
|
|||||||
" Use Ctrl+Shift+jk to resize panes
|
" Use Ctrl+Shift+jk to resize panes
|
||||||
nnoremap <C-j> :resize -2<CR>
|
nnoremap <C-j> :resize -2<CR>
|
||||||
nnoremap <C-k> :resize +2<CR>
|
nnoremap <C-k> :resize +2<CR>
|
||||||
|
|
||||||
|
" Use advance-touch to create files
|
||||||
|
nnoremap <leader>f :! ad
|
||||||
|
|||||||
Reference in New Issue
Block a user